speechlessness
Definitions
The state of being unable to speak, typically due to strong emotion or shock.
A temporary or permanent lack of the ability to use spoken language.
Examples
Her sudden speechlessness after the announcement revealed the depth of her shock.
The sheer beauty of the mountain range left the hikers in a state of complete speechlessness.
He struggled to overcome his speechlessness when he was unexpectedly called to the stage.
Synonyms
muteness silence dumbness taciturnity reticence wordlessness voicelessness
Antonyms
loquacity talkativeness volubility garrulity verbosity articulation communicativeness
